Financial Examiners Salary in South Carolina

Median Annual Salary $72,030 -20% below national average (national: $90,400)
$85,050Mean Annual
$35Median Hourly
360Employed in State

South Carolina ranks 44th of 50 states and D.C. for financial examiners pay, trailing top-paying District of Columbia ($177,550) by $105,520 — a 146% gap.

The 10th-to-90th percentile range runs from $48,660 to $131,820 — a $83,160 spread, 30% tighter than the national $118,120 range.

Financial Examiners are less concentrated in South Carolina than the U.S. average — a location quotient of 0.39 means the occupation's share of local jobs is 2.56× below the national share.

Full Percentile Breakdown

PercentileAnnual WageHourly Wage
10th percentile (entry-level)$48,660$23.40
25th percentile$63,240$30.41
50th percentile (median)$72,030$34.63
75th percentile$102,420$49.24
90th percentile (top earners)$131,820$63.38
Mean (average)$85,050$40.89
